Fine artist, muralist, educator, and curator Alice Mizrachi premieres a new body of work, “FLOW: RELEASE AND SURRENDER” which features numerous artworks covering an expansive plethora of mediums. Throughout her career, Mizrachi has shown that she can excel using a myriad of techniques. FLOW: RELEASE AND SURRENDER will explore a selection of her diverse practice: minimalist works on paper, mixed media collage works, assemblages, and ceramic works. Mizrachi’s drawings on paper are the product of what she describes as “totally surrendering to the moment, allowing instincts and her subconscious to take over.” With visceral strokes of vibrant color on a variety of paper types, fluidly connecting one color to the next. Though Mizrachi’s creative process is driven by intuition, the artist also brings a precision to her interpretation due to her masterful line work. The mixed media collages are created using rich layers of handmade paper and upcycled materials. These collages illustrate the influence of The Harlem Renaissance implementing collage techniques used by artists like Romare Bearden. An essential part of the artist’s practice explores the heritage of the divine feminine imagery, most apparent in the marquee works of the exhibition. The ceramic works reflect the artist’s first foray with working in clay, introducing another dimension to the FLOW series. Over the past few decades, Mizrachi draws from a variety of cultural references in her practice. The ceramic masks, in particular, have a distinct sense of familiarity. Moreover it appears as if the brush strokes and line work could not be contained on paper and were compelled to take a more corporeal form. This evolution in Mizrachi’s practice has resulted in the production of these intriguing sculptures. "FLOW: Release and Surrender" celebrates what’s possible when an artist completely submits to the process and trusts their instincts. |
